Historical Significance

Established in the late 1800s, Kapiolani Park holds a special place in the history of Oahu. It was named after Queen Kapiolani, the wife of King Kalakaua, and was one of the first public parks in Hawaii. Today, the park stands as a testament to the island's rich cultural heritage.

Park Features


  • Beautiful Gardens: Kapiolani Park is home to lush greenery, vibrant flowers, and towering trees that create a picturesque backdrop for leisurely strolls and picnics.

  • Waikiki Shell: This iconic concert venue within the park hosts a variety of performances throughout the year, from live music to cultural events.

  • Diamond Head: The park offers stunning views of Diamond Head, a volcanic crater that has become a symbol of Oahu's natural beauty.
